Third Period: 10:24 – Domi takes a run at Leschyshyn. Neil immediately comes over and they drop the gloves. Neil gets in a right, and it’s pretty much all Domi from here, as they start to spin a bit and Domi lands a few lefts, misses on one or two more. They go down and try to get back up, but the linesmen stop it. Pretty short bout.
